58165829250048000

58,165,829,250,048,000 is an even composite number composed of seven pr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 58165829250048000 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 7 prime factors (large circles) and 4480 divisors.

58165829250048000 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of four thousand, four hundred eighty divisors.

Prime factorization of 58165829250048000:

213 × 34 × 53 × 13 × 53 × 631 × 1613

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 13 × 53 × 631 × 1613)
